@MeEasy Sir I have a question. What is typical timeframe for roots to dissolve when you ammend and cook in bag? I remember you posted something about it. I have been tossing in my big bin but would rather add soil to bag amd cook it there reammended.

1 Like

I have a bunch of soil and after a grow I leave the stumps in the pots keeping it moist for the next grow and when I go to mix the soil the stumps come out with two fingers. There’s still some roots in it but it’s nothing like the solid root balls I would fight with before I started doing this. Here’s a stump I pulled out

The other day I saw someone fighting with some wpm and they found a new product that worked really good. For some reason I think it was @SilvaBack203 but we all know my memory muscle is broken :laughing:

7 Likes

The product is called AGrowlyte.

It’s basically some hypochlorous acid (0.46% concentration if I remember correctly).
You can buy it already made, AGrowlyte and Root Drip by Floraflex, or you can buy an inexpensive machine and make your own…
